The UK’s crude steel production has fallen to a historic low as the country transitions from blast furnace steelmaking to electric arc furnace (EAF) production, marking a fundamental shift for the birthplace of the Industrial Revolution and modern steelmaking.
According to a report published by Japan-based Steel Recycling Research, the UK’s crude steel production fell 29% y-o-y to 4.01 million tonnes (mnt) in 2024. Preliminary estimates suggest output declined further to 2.6 mnt in 2025, the lowest level since 1886, when production stood at 2.3 mnt. Current output is less than one-tenth of the record 27.83 mnt produced in 1970.
Blast furnace era draws to a close
The report attributes the sharp fall in production to the structural transition from blast furnace steelmaking to EAF production.
Tata Steel UK, the country’s largest blast furnace operator, shut down and began dismantling the ageing blast furnaces at its Port Talbot steelworks in South Wales in July and September 2024 after profitability deteriorated due to ageing facilities, competition from Chinese steel imports, high energy prices, and mounting pressure to reduce CO2 emissions. The closures have effectively removed most of the UK’s blast furnace capacity.
The company is investing several billion pounds to build a new 3 mnt-per-year EAF at the site. Construction began in July 2025, and commercial operations are targeted for the end of 2027. Once operational, the furnace is expected to reduce CO2 emissions by around 90%. During the transition period between 2025 and 2027, Tata Steel plans to import slabs to keep its rolling and galvanising operations running.
Meanwhile, British Steel’s integrated steelworks at Scunthorpe remains the UK’s only operating blast furnace facility. After its Chinese parent, Jingye Group, considered closing the furnaces in spring 2025, the UK government intervened through emergency legislation to keep production running and has since indicated it is seriously considering nationalising the company.
British Steel is viewed as strategically important because it supplies railway rails and supports national infrastructure and defence needs. The report notes growing concerns that the UK could become the only G7 nation without blast furnace capacity if the plant eventually closes.
Steel demand increasingly met through imports
Despite ranking among the world’s wealthiest economies with GDP per capita of around $56,700, the UK’s apparent steel consumption stood at just 133 kg per capita in 2024, ranking 67th globally and less than half the EU-27 average of 291 kg.
The report attributes the relatively low steel intensity to a services-led economy accounting for around 80% of GDP, manufacturing contributing only about 9%, mature infrastructure requiring mainly maintenance and renewal, housing construction dominated by brick and timber, and the long-term decline of shipbuilding and heavy industry.
Domestic steel demand totalled around 9.0-9.21 mnt in 2024, with construction accounting for about 40% of consumption. Imports supplied around 74% of domestic demand, while 64% of imported steel originated from the EU, highlighting the UK’s growing reliance on overseas supply.
World’s most prominent scrap exporter
The UK has also emerged as one of the world’s most significant ferrous scrap exporters.
The country exported 7.64 mnt of scrap in 2024, around nine times its domestic market scrap consumption of 840,000 tonnes (t). Approximately 90% of the country’s 8.48 million tonnes of annual scrap generation were exported, prompting the report to describe the UK as “an exceptionally extreme scrap exporting country” with few global parallels.

Turkiye accounted for 26.5% of scrap exports, while the EU-15 received 18.1%, taking Europe’s combined share to 45%. Africa accounted for 29.6%, followed by Asia, including India and Pakistan, at 23.1%.
The UK’s accumulated in-use steel stock was estimated at 790 mnt at the end of 2024. The recovery rate for obsolete scrap stood at 0.95%, compared with Japan’s 1.55% in the same year. Obsolete scrap accounted for 87% of total scrap generation, while prompt scrap represented only 13%, reflecting the country’s relatively small manufacturing sector.
Scrap policy debate gathers pace
The expansion of EAF steelmaking has intensified debate over whether the UK should retain more scrap for domestic steel production.
Steel industry association UK Steel has urged the government to restrict scrap exports outside the OECD and prioritise domestic use of high-quality scrap, arguing that future shortages could emerge as EAF capacity expands.
The recycling industry association British Metals Recycling Association (BMRA) disputes that assessment, arguing that even if all remaining blast furnaces were replaced with EAFs using 100% scrap, the UK would still require only around two-thirds of the scrap it generates domestically.
Both organisations, however, support greater investment in scrap upgrading technologies, including AI-based sorting and copper removal. The UK government’s 2025 Steel Strategy includes around £2.5 billion of support and identifies advanced scrap processing and sorting facilities as a policy priority.
Recovery expected, but industry will remain much smaller
The report projects the UK’s crude steel production will recover gradually to 4.5 mnt by 2030 and 5 mnt by 2050, although a return to the more than 25 mnt produced during the 1970s is considered highly unlikely.
The production mix is expected to reverse from 71.7% basic oxygen furnace steelmaking and 28.3% EAF production in 2024 to 35.6% and 64.4%, respectively, by 2030. By 2050, EAFs are projected to account for around 67% of production.
Scrap exports are expected to remain close to 6 mnt annually through 2050, suggesting the UK will continue to be a net exporter of ferrous scrap even after completing its steelmaking transition.
The report concludes that while import dependence may make economic sense, questions remain over how much domestic steelmaking capacity the UK should retain from the perspective of national security, infrastructure resilience, defence industries, and supply chain security.
It also proposes that the UK could position itself as Europe’s strategic supplier of pig iron and semi-finished steel, particularly after the EU lost access to Russian feedstock. The report argues that the UK’s geographical proximity gives it a freight advantage over Brazilian suppliers, with shipping distances to Italy of around 1,500-2,000 km compared with 8,000-9,000 km from Brazil.
Rather than attempting to reclaim its former position as one of the world’s largest steel producers, the report concludes the UK is evolving into “an indispensable steel nation for Europe” while becoming one of the first countries to confront the challenge of balancing decarbonisation with industrial competitiveness.
